For years, Jena Wiebe built her identity around hustle, achievement, independence, and success. She was outspoken, ambitious, and openly atheist; focused on building the life she thought would finally bring fulfillment. But eventually, the constant striving stopped working. In this deeply honest conversation, Jena shares what led her away from a life centered on money, status, and self reliance…and down a path of faith, peace, femininity, and a relationship with God she never expected to have. We talk about ambition, identity, burnout, modern culture, personal transformation, and what happens when your priorities and your heart begin to change. Fuel, Ignite & Thrive: Nutritionist Tania Gustafson on Midlife Hormones, Blood Sugar & Honouring God With Your Body

Tania Gustafson is a board-certified nutritionist and behavior specialist who has spent her career helping women rediscover their strength — not through restriction, but through renewal. From a health scare as a teenager to years spent unlearning diet culture, Tania now coaches women through her Fuel Ignite and Thrive program and hosts The Fit Woman Podcast. In this episode, Toby sits down with Tania to talk about what it really means to care for the body God gave us in midlife. They dig into why blood sugar balance is the foundation for hormone health, how chronic inflammation acts like a "check engine light" for our bodies, and why intentional morning rest can change the whole trajectory of your day. Tania also opens up about her own faith journey and how honouring God with her health became an act of worship rather than vanity. Whether you're navigating menopause, feeling stuck in old dieting habits, or just looking for permission to slow down and reset — this one's for you. Faith in the Locker Room: Sports Chaplain Don Richmond on Athletes, Identity & Showing Up

For over 20 years, Don Richmond has had a front-row seat to the lives of young athletes across the Okanagan — as a sports chaplain to hockey teams, football programs, and more. He's been there for the highest highs and the lowest lows, quietly serving players, coaches, and families one pizza-and-Orange-Crush chapel at a time. In this episode, Toby sits down with Pastor Don to talk about what it really means to show up for people, how faith takes root in unexpected places, and why locker rooms are still some of the most honest spaces for conversations about God. Don shares the story of how it all started, what he's learned from decades of ministry with young men, and his simple but powerful life philosophy: Just Show Up. Whether you're a parent, a coach, an athlete, or someone wondering how faith fits into everyday real life — this one's for you.
